Circuit Breaker Installation in Prescott Valley, AZ
Circuit breaker installation services involve replacing or upgrading your home's main electrical panel to ensure safe and reliable power distribution throughout the property. This service covers projects such as installing new circuit breakers, upgrading outdated panels, or adding additional circuits to accommodate expanded electrical needs. Property owners typically seek this service when experiencing frequent breaker trips, planning home renovations, or installing new appliances that require additional electrical capacity, helping to prevent electrical issues and improve overall safety.
Before requesting circuit breaker installation, homeowners often want to understand the compatibility of new breakers with existing panels, the importance of proper sizing for their electrical load, and any necessary permits or inspections involved in the process. It’s also common to inquire about the signs indicating a need for panel upgrades, such as flickering lights or burning smells, to ensure their electrical system remains safe and efficient for years to come.

Circuit Breaker Installation Questions
What is a circuit breaker? A circuit breaker is a safety device that protects electrical systems by stopping power flow during overloads or faults.
When should a circuit breaker be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the breaker trips frequently, shows signs of damage, or has been in use for many years.
Can a homeowner install a circuit breaker? Installation should be performed by a qualified electrician to ensure safety and code compliance.
What types of projects typically require circuit breaker installation? New electrical panel setups, upgrades for increased capacity, or replacing outdated breakers often involve installation services.
